Allow user to resize a graphic around its center by dragging
Last modified: 2013-02-07 22:39:46 UTC
We can drag the handles of a graphic to resize it manually. We can use SHFT to resize it without changing its aspect ratio. But we cannot resize it around its center. As a result, after resizing, we have to move the object to locate it on its previous center. This is especially true if the location of the object in the figure is important. Of course, the Graphic dialog's context menu has the "Position and size..." option (select the "position and size" tab). There we can set the Base point, but it works only if you immediately enter a new value in the input boxes. In other words, this control is not related to the "drag-the-handles-to-resize-the-graphic" operation. Often we have to resize the object visually (by dragging the handles); as we don't know the exact value to enter in the dialog. Powerpoint provides SHFT+CTRL+drag to resize the object around its present center. Provide a similar facility in Impress.
In fact, we can have separate modifiers: (a) Symmatrical resizing along one axis (the actual axis of resizing will depend on which handle is being dragged), and (b) Symmatrical around the center (all axes). In powerpoint, SHFT gives symmatry around a single axis, and CTRL+SHFT gives symmatry around center.
